Your Guide to Finding the Best Foundation for Big Pores
Big pores can sometimes make your skin look uneven. Finding the right foundation can make a huge difference. This guide helps you choose the best one for you. We look at what matters most so you get a smooth, flawless finish.
1. Key Features to Look For
When shopping, look for these important features. They help the foundation work hard for your skin.
- Pore-Minimizing Effect: The best foundations will instantly blur or fill in the look of large pores. This creates a smooth canvas.
- Mattifying Finish: If you have oily skin along with big pores, a matte finish helps control shine all day.
- Lightweight Feel: Heavy foundations can settle into pores, making them look worse. Choose something light that lets your skin breathe.
- Long-Lasting Wear: You want a foundation that stays put, even when pores are trying to show through. Look for “long-wear” or “12-hour” claims.
2. Important Ingredients and Materials
The ingredients inside the bottle really matter. Some things help hide pores, while others can make skin look better over time.
Blurring Agents
Look for ingredients that physically fill the space of the pore temporarily. These often include things like silicone derivatives (like Dimethicone). These ingredients create a smooth, light-reflecting surface.
Skin-Improving Ingredients
Good foundations do more than just cover up. Ingredients like Niacinamide are great because they can help improve the appearance of pores over time with regular use. Salicylic Acid (BHA) can also help keep pores clean.
Oil Control Components
For many people with big pores, oil is a problem. Ingredients like silica or special clay powders absorb excess oil throughout the day. This keeps your makeup looking fresh and prevents that shiny look.
3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all foundations perform the same way. A few factors can really change how well a product works for minimizing pores.
What Improves Quality:
- Primer Integration: A foundation that works well over a good pore-filling primer gives the best results.
- Fine Milling: High-quality foundations use very finely ground pigments and powders. These blend seamlessly without emphasizing texture.
- Good Shade Match: If the color is wrong, the texture will look more obvious. Always test the shade in good light.
What Reduces Quality:
- Heavy Oils: Foundations loaded with heavy, pore-clogging oils can make pores look larger as the day goes on.
- Thick Formulas: Very thick or cakey formulas tend to sit on top of the skin. They settle right into the indentations of the pores.
- Lack of Adhesion: If the foundation doesn’t stick well to the skin, it will slide around, exposing the texture underneath.
4. User Experience and Use Cases
How you use the foundation affects the final look. Think about when and where you plan to wear it.
Application Technique
For the best pore coverage, use a dense, flat-top brush or a damp makeup sponge. Gently *press* or *stipple* the product onto the skin, especially in the T-zone area where pores are most visible. Do not drag or wipe the product across your face; this pushes it into the pores instead of smoothing over them.
Best Use Cases
- Daily Wear: Choose a medium-coverage, satin-matte formula. These offer good blurring without feeling too heavy for everyday tasks.
- Special Events/Photos: You might opt for a slightly fuller coverage foundation that contains light-diffusing particles. These work wonders under bright lights and cameras.
- Oily Skin Days: Layer a very thin layer of a mattifying setting powder over the foundation in your problem areas for maximum staying power.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Foundation for Big Pores
Q: Does foundation actually shrink my pores?
A: No, foundation cannot permanently shrink your pores. It covers them up and makes them look much smaller while you wear the makeup.
Q: Should I use a primer before foundation?
A: Yes, using a pore-filling primer underneath is highly recommended. The primer fills the gaps first, and the foundation sits smoothly on top.
Q: Are matte foundations always better for big pores?
A: Matte foundations often work best because they control shine, which can emphasize pores. However, a “satin” finish can look more natural if your skin is not overly oily.
Q: Can I use a dewy foundation if I have large pores?
A: Dewy finishes emphasize texture. If you love a dewy look, use a very mattifying primer and set the foundation lightly with a translucent powder.
Q: What is the best way to apply this type of foundation?
A: Pressing or bouncing the product onto the skin with a dense brush or sponge works best. This pushes the product into the pore openings for a smoother look.
Q: Will heavy foundation make my pores look worse later in the day?
A: Yes, heavy or oily foundations often break down. As they fade, they can settle into the pores, making them look more noticeable than before you applied makeup.
Q: Should I choose a liquid or powder foundation?
A: Liquid foundations formulated for smoothing often provide better immediate coverage. However, a very finely milled powder foundation can be great for touch-ups throughout the day.
Q: Are foundations with SPF good for covering pores?
A: Many modern foundations include SPF. As long as the formula is not too greasy, SPF protection is a great bonus feature that doesn’t usually hurt pore coverage.
Q: How long should this foundation last?
A: Look for formulas labeled as “long-wear,” meaning they should stay put for at least eight to twelve hours without sliding off the texture of your skin.
Q: What is the most important thing to wash off at night?
A: You must thoroughly remove all makeup every night. Leftover foundation can mix with oil and dirt, which clogs pores and makes them look larger over time.
